Installing SNMP in Windows You must be logged on as an administrator or a member of the Administrators group to complete this procedure. If your computer is connected to a network, network policy settings may also prevent you from completing this procedure. - Click Start, point to Settings, click Control Panel, double-click Add or Remove Programs, and then click Add/Remove Windows Components.
- In Components, click Management and Monitoring Tools, and then click Details.
- Select the Simple Network Management Protocol check box, and click OK.
- Click Next.
- Insert the respective CD or specify the complete path of the location at which the files stored.
- SNMP starts automatically after installation.
Configuring SNMP Agent in Windows
To configure SNMP agent in Windows XP and 2000 systems, follow the steps given below: - Click Start, point to Settings, click Control Panel.
- Under Administrative Tools, click Services.
- In the details pane, right-click SNMP Service and select Properties.
- In the Security tab, select Send authentication trap if you want a trap message to be sent whenever authentication fails.
- Under Accepted community names, click Add.
- Under Community Rights, select a permission level for this host to process SNMP requests from the selected community.
- In Community Name, type a case-sensitive community name, and then click Add.
- Click Accept SNMP packets from these hosts, click Add, type the appropriate host name, IP or IPX address, and then click Add again.
- Click Apply to apply the changes.
Configuring SNMP Traps in Windows To configure SNMP traps, follow the steps given below: - Click Start, point to Settings, click Control Panel.
- Under Administrative Tools, click Services.
- In the details pane, right-click SNMP Service and select Properties.
- In the Traps tab, under Community name, type the case-sensitive community name, and then click Add to list.
- Under Trap destinations, click Add. In the Host name, IP or IPX address field, type host name or its IP address of the server to send the trap, and click Add.
- Click OK to apply the changes.
